The best time to visit Florence is during the spring (April-May) or fall (September-October). The weather is mild, and there are fewer crowds compared to the peak summer months. Avoid August, when many locals go on holiday and some businesses may be closed.
Florence Airport (FLR), also known as Peretola Airport, is well-connected to the city center. The tram is a quick and affordable option, costing around €1.50 and taking about 20 minutes. Taxis are also available for approximately €22-€25.
Visit the Uffizi Gallery: See masterpieces of Renaissance art, including works by Botticelli and Leonardo da Vinci. Climb the Duomo: Enjoy panoramic views of Florence from the top of Brunelleschi's Dome. Cross the Ponte Vecchio: Admire the shops built along this historic bridge, the only one spared from destruction during World War II. Explore the Boboli Gardens: Wander through the expansive gardens behind the Pitti Palace, featuring sculptures and fountains.
Try the Florentine steak (Bistecca alla Fiorentina), a thick-cut steak grilled to perfection. Sample Lampredotto, a traditional Florentine street food made from the fourth stomach of a cow, served in a bread roll. Don't miss out on the gelato, especially artisanal flavors from local gelaterias.
Learn a few basic Italian phrases to enhance your interactions with locals. Be aware of pickpockets, especially in crowded tourist areas. Validate your train tickets before boarding to avoid fines.
